PINEAPPLE COOLER



Pineapple Cooler image

This is a most extraordinary drink. It sounds so unlikely, but it really does taste good - not like pineapple but more like cider. It's very refreshing on a hot summer's day, and it's great fun to make in that it uses only the skin of the pineapple which is normally thrown away - so there's nothing to lose!

Categories     Delia's Summer Collection     Drinks     Summer

Yield Serves 6-8

Number Of Ingredients 4

the rind of 1 medium pineapple, well rinsed
approximately 2 oz (50 g) caster sugar
sprigs of mint
ice

Steps:

  • First of all cut the stalky top and the base off the pineapple and discard these. Now stand the pineapple upright on its base and, using a sharp knife, cut away the skin in long strips, working your way all round the fruit. Reserve the fruit itself for a dessert. Now get to work with a sharp knife, chopping the skin into small pieces about 1 inch (2.5 cm) square. Then pile them all into a bowl, pour over 1½ pints (850 ml) cold water, then cover the bowl with a cloth and leave at room temperature for 3-4 days or until the mixture is bubbly and fermenting. Strain it into a jug, add sugar to taste and serve with lots of ice and sprigs of mint.

PINEAPPLE COOLER



Pineapple Cooler image

In Littlerock, California, Michelle Blumberg stirs up this mild and refreshing beverage in a jiffy. Lemon juice cuts the sweetness you might expect from pineapple juice and lemon-lime soda.

Provided by Taste of Home

Time 5m

Yield 2-2/3 cups.

Number Of Ingredients 4

1 cup unsweetened pineapple juice, chilled
1 to 2 tablespoons lemon juice
1 can (12 ounces) lemon-lime soda, chilled
Ice cubes

Steps:

  • Combine all ingredients in a pitcher. Serve over ice.

REFRESCO DE PINA - PINEAPPLE COOLER



Refresco De Pina - Pineapple Cooler image

This recipe (as well as the one I posted called Atole) were ones that I got in school for a celebration my Spanish class was to be having. They sound very good, and I hope that you enjoy making and drinking them:)

Provided by Jenna5230

Categories     Beverages

Time 2h5m

Yield 4-5 cups, 4-5 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 3

1 ripe pineapple, peeled
1 quart water
1/2 cup sugar (or more)

Steps:

  • Chop pineapple into small bits or cut into chunks and blend for a moment in a blender.
  • In a glass container, add the pineapple to one quart of water in which half of the sugar has been dissolved.
  • Allow to steep for 2 to 3 hours.
  • Strain and add additional sugar to personal taste.
  • Chill and serve.
  • Makes 4 to 5 cups.
